Literature summary for 3.1.1.4 extracted from

  • Tsai, I.; Tsai, H.; Wang, Y.; Tun-P, T.; Warrell, D.A.
    Venom phospholipases of Russells vipers from Myanmar and eastern India-Cloning, characterization and phylogeographic analysis (2007), Biochim. Biophys. Acta, 1774, 1020-1028.
    View publication on PubMed

Cloned(Commentary)

Cloned (Comment) Organism
isozymes DrK-aI, DrK-aII, DrK-bI, and DrK-bII, DNA and amino acid sequence determination and analysis, phylogenetic analysis Daboia russelii
isozymes DsM-bI and DsM-S1, DNA and amino acid sequence determination and analysis, phylogenetic analysis Daboia siamensis
